HC Deb 31 October 1990 vol 178 c631W
Mr. Teddy Taylor

To ask the Minister of Agriculture, Fisheries and Food if he will make a statement on the recent incidents in France relating to the import of British livestock; and what action he has taken.

Mr. Curry

My colleagues and I have made it absolutely clear to the French Government and in the Council of Agriculture Ministers that we totally condemn the incidents in France involving attacks on imported livestock and carcases. As a result of our sustained pressure, the French authorities expressed their determination to maintain law and order and to take action against those concerned in the incidents. They have also said that they will compensate for financial losses arising as a direct result of the incidents. We remain determined to ensure the safety and free passage of animals, drivers and goods. We shall continue to monitor the situation and will not hesitate to raise the matter again with the French authorities if further incidents threaten our trade.
